|
5900c13e08
|
docs(development): Add initial TicketCommentBase
ref: #744 #726
|
2025-05-09 16:21:42 +09:30 |
|
|
d399698eb1
|
test(core): Unit Model assert save and call are called for TicketBase
ref: #744 #723
|
2025-05-09 16:20:44 +09:30 |
|
|
457d329b0b
|
fix(core): Correct logic for TicketCommentSolution
ref: #744 #728
|
2025-05-09 16:19:57 +09:30 |
|
|
45c428d30a
|
fix(core): Correct logic for TicketCommentBase
ref: #744 #726
|
2025-05-09 16:19:33 +09:30 |
|
|
7ddb72239e
|
chore(python): Add testing dep pytest-mock
ref: #744
|
2025-05-09 16:13:38 +09:30 |
|
|
580820ef44
|
test(core): Unit Model Checks for TicketCommentSolution
ref: #744 #728
|
2025-05-09 16:11:59 +09:30 |
|
|
d037150eb3
|
test(core): Unit Model Checks for TicketCommentBase
ref: #744 #726
|
2025-05-09 16:10:45 +09:30 |
|
|
35a102e4a9
|
Merge pull request #742 from nofusscomputing/test-asset-base
|
2025-05-08 15:44:35 +09:30 |
|
|
f7c75df9be
|
docs(itam): Add IT Asset
ref: #742 closes #692
|
2025-05-08 15:30:11 +09:30 |
|
|
d0e18fe75a
|
docs(development): Add Asset
ref: #742 closes #737
|
2025-05-08 15:29:59 +09:30 |
|
|
e30c08fd5b
|
test(itam): test meta attribute itam_sub_model_type for ITAMBaseModel
ref: #742 #692
|
2025-05-08 15:10:38 +09:30 |
|
|
1058659174
|
test(itam): Dont use constants where variables should be used
ref: #742
|
2025-05-08 14:54:03 +09:30 |
|
|
b9ac588f87
|
test(itam): Remaining Unit Model test cases for AssetBase
ref: #742 #692
|
2025-05-08 14:54:03 +09:30 |
|
|
40b4bb0a3e
|
test(accounting): Remaining Unit Model test cases for AssetBase
ref: #742 #737
|
2025-05-08 14:54:03 +09:30 |
|
|
9bd9652b3d
|
fix(accounting): Ensure correct sub-model check is conducted within model type
ref: #742 #737
|
2025-05-08 14:47:56 +09:30 |
|
|
46c4fe9516
|
fix(itam): ensure RO field asset_type is set
ref: #742 #692
|
2025-05-08 14:25:47 +09:30 |
|
|
a71b5e6aba
|
test(itam): Functional ViewSet Test Cases for ITAMAssetBase
ref: #742 #692
|
2025-05-08 13:42:24 +09:30 |
|
|
e0cbf1447f
|
test(itam): Functional Serializer Test Cases for ITAMAssetBase
ref: #742 #692
|
2025-05-08 13:42:06 +09:30 |
|
|
b69e54f1e9
|
test(itam): Functional Permissions Test Cases for ITAMAssetBase
ref: #742 #692
|
2025-05-08 13:41:56 +09:30 |
|
|
ecb1c21179
|
test(itam): Functional Metadata Test Cases for ITAMAssetBase
ref: #742 #692
|
2025-05-08 13:41:49 +09:30 |
|
|
acff19ad58
|
test(itam): Functional History Test Cases for ITAMAssetBase
ref: #742 #692
|
2025-05-08 13:41:41 +09:30 |
|
|
f79f796a14
|
test(accounting): Functional ViewSet Test Cases for AssetBase
ref: #742 #737
|
2025-05-08 13:40:59 +09:30 |
|
|
a08a43e2bd
|
test(accounting): Functional Serializer Test Cases for AssetBase
ref: #742 #737
|
2025-05-08 13:40:51 +09:30 |
|
|
8238e97a45
|
test(accounting): Functional Permissions Test Cases for AssetBase
ref: #742 #737
|
2025-05-08 13:40:44 +09:30 |
|
|
88202b57ee
|
test(accounting): Functional Metadata Test Cases for AssetBase
ref: #742 #737
|
2025-05-08 13:40:36 +09:30 |
|
|
324fa39b56
|
test(accounting): History Test Cases for AssetBase
ref: #742 #737
|
2025-05-08 13:40:23 +09:30 |
|
|
233393e853
|
test: add missing merge of add_data for api permissions tests
ref: #742 #730
|
2025-05-08 13:38:56 +09:30 |
|
|
84afc3274a
|
test: remove ticket only vars from api permissions tests
ref: #742 #730
|
2025-05-08 12:28:19 +09:30 |
|
|
a5bfc4977d
|
Merge pull request #741 from nofusscomputing/base-asset-model
|
2025-05-06 04:20:14 +09:30 |
|
|
19205bbe8b
|
feat(itam): Add Feature Flag 2025-00007 ITAMAssetBase
ref: #741 #692
|
2025-05-06 03:58:29 +09:30 |
|
|
f144e0b8ef
|
feat(itam): Add endpoint for ITAMAssetBase
ref: #741 #692
|
2025-05-06 03:58:01 +09:30 |
|
|
8473d00148
|
feat: Model tag migration for Asset and IT Asset
ref: #741 #737 #692
|
2025-05-06 02:09:44 +09:30 |
|
|
c8391caf07
|
feat(itam): Model tag for ITAsset
ref: #741 #692
|
2025-05-06 02:08:17 +09:30 |
|
|
d19bb3a204
|
feat(accounting): Model tag for Asset
ref: #741 #737
|
2025-05-06 02:07:38 +09:30 |
|
|
ed71e935fc
|
test(api): dont use constants for variable data
ref: #741
|
2025-05-06 01:43:38 +09:30 |
|
|
5ba243a1ea
|
test: correct viewset tests
ref: #741
|
2025-05-06 00:48:29 +09:30 |
|
|
88a30650a5
|
test(itam): Unit Viewset checks for AssetBase Model
ref: #741 #692
|
2025-05-05 22:10:50 +09:30 |
|
|
420b223ca4
|
test(core): Add missing fields is_global checks for ticket base
ref: #741 #723
|
2025-05-05 22:08:42 +09:30 |
|
|
7168d519d1
|
test(api): Add submodel url resolution for metadata
ref: #741
|
2025-05-05 22:07:56 +09:30 |
|
|
4a09463f0a
|
test(itam): Unit API Fields checks for ITAM AssetBase Model
ref: #741 #692
|
2025-05-05 20:45:30 +09:30 |
|
|
0a52029840
|
test(accounting): Unit API Fields checks for AssetBase Model
ref: #741 #737
|
2025-05-05 20:44:56 +09:30 |
|
|
6841b30a77
|
test: Support variables that were defined as properties.
ref: #741
|
2025-05-05 20:34:23 +09:30 |
|
|
dbaff89b8d
|
test(api): Ensure that model notes is added to model create for api field tests
ref: #741
|
2025-05-05 17:49:17 +09:30 |
|
|
b7cd9ea75c
|
fix(itim): Ensure that itam base model is always imported
ref: #741 #692
|
2025-05-05 17:33:30 +09:30 |
|
|
b54f3b7ab4
|
refactor(api): Limit url pk regex to ensure the value is a number
ref: #741
|
2025-05-05 17:22:08 +09:30 |
|
|
83d7c38c38
|
docs(accounting): added interim
ref: #741 #737
|
2025-05-05 16:58:44 +09:30 |
|
|
644dbc8159
|
feat(accounting): Add app label to kb articles for notes
ref: #741 #737
|
2025-05-05 16:38:41 +09:30 |
|
|
e566a5edf1
|
chore: add link to issue template for clarity of sub-model history variables
ref: #741
|
2025-05-05 16:35:03 +09:30 |
|
|
ef5c6b73af
|
feat(accounting): Migrations for notes model for AssetBase
ref: #741 #737
|
2025-05-05 16:24:34 +09:30 |
|
|
3d7b133005
|
feat(accounting): Migrations for history model for AssetBase
ref: #741 #737
|
2025-05-05 16:24:24 +09:30 |
|